The intake gasket is a crucial component in an engine, sealing the intake manifold to the cylinder head. When an engine overheats, it can cause significant damage to this gasket, leading to costly repairs and engine performance issues.
How Overheating Affects the Intake Gasket
Overheating occurs when the engine temperature exceeds the normal operating range. This excessive heat can cause the materials of the intake gasket to expand, warp, or crack. As a result, the seal becomes compromised, allowing air, coolant, or oil to leak, which can lead to engine misfires, loss of power, or overheating further damage.
Signs of Gasket Damage Due to Overheating
- Coolant leaks around the intake manifold
- Engine overheating or temperature fluctuations
- Loss of power or rough idling
- White smoke from the exhaust
- Milky oil indicating coolant mixing
How to Fix a Damaged Intake Gasket
Replacing a damaged intake gasket involves several steps. It’s recommended to have a professional mechanic perform this task, but here is an overview of the process:
- Allow the engine to cool completely before starting work.
- Drain the coolant and disconnect the battery.
- Remove components obstructing access to the intake manifold.
- Unbolt and carefully remove the old gasket.
- Clean the mating surfaces thoroughly to remove any residue.
- Place a new gasket in position, ensuring proper alignment.
- Reassemble the components in reverse order, refill coolant, and check for leaks.
Preventing Future Damage
To prevent overheating and gasket damage in the future, ensure your cooling system is well-maintained. Regularly check coolant levels, inspect hoses and the radiator for leaks, and address any engine temperature issues promptly. Proper maintenance extends the life of your engine components and keeps your vehicle running smoothly.
